Urinary concentration and fractional excretion of neutrophil gelatinase-associated lipocalin (NGAL) in patients clustered in groups according to glomerular filtration rate (GFR; upper part) or according to plasma concentrations (lower part). Mean values and standard deviations are reported. The statistical significance of the differences versus the mean values in patients with GFR >90 ml/minute/1.73 m2 and versus the mean values in patients with the lowest blood concentrations of plasma NGAL are reported. *P < 0.05.Back to article page
